Vista Energy (NYSE:VISTGet Free Report) announced its earnings results on Wednesday. The company reported $0.49 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.34 by ($0.85), Zacks reports. Vista Energy had a net margin of 32.66% and a return on equity of 15.92%.

Vista Energy Price Performance

VIST traded down $0.76 during trading on Wednesday, reaching $56.75. 847,081 shares of the company traded hands, compared to its average volume of 1,231,252. The company has a market cap of $5.92 billion, a P/E ratio of 8.34, a PEG ratio of 2.49 and a beta of 0.82.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.98, a quick ratio of 0.61 and a current ratio of 0.62. Vista Energy has a 12-month low of $31.63 and a 12-month high of $62.42. The firm has a fifty day simple moving average of $51.83 and a 200 day simple moving average of $45.62.

Vista Energy (NYSE: VIST) is an independent energy company focused on the exploration, development and production of oil and natural gas resources in Mexico. The company operates through two primary segments: upstream exploration and production, and midstream and specialist services. By integrating both segments, Vista Energy seeks to capture value across the energy value chain, from field operations to the delivery of processed gas to industrial and power-generation customers.

In its upstream segment, Vista Energy holds interests in onshore gas fields in northeastern Mexico and shallow-water properties in the Bay of Campeche.
